BUt off the top of my head the team drivers have used both motors. The brushed setup was something like a 35T handwound motor , 16 to 18 tooth pinion , with 3s lipo batteries. The usuall top of the line esc have been recommended, goat, sidewinder, Tekin, mamba etc. Keep in mind that the worm gears in the final drive will not turn when there is no power to them so they are the best brakes you can get so with that you just need to get an esc that fits your other needs (brushed, brushless,lipo cutoff etc) instead of fancy drag brake set-ups.
